Billy Bob Thornton is a dude that can seem like a genius one minute and a raving lunatic the next. He appeared on Bill Maher last week and had a great point that really made me think about the state of Modern Music. He put it this way……. Think of all the great artists in music that all started their careers between the years of 1955-1975. For example…..Elvis, Chuck Berry, The Rolling Stones, The Beatles, The Doors, Elton John, Bob Dylan, Michael Jackson, The Eagles, Etc. There are literally tons of huge musical talents that all got their starts in that era. That music will live on for centuries and those artists will be famous for centuries. Now, name the acts that have popped up since 1975 that you think will be famous centuries from now. When compared to the 1955-1975 era, there are very few. Madonna is one, Bruce Springsteen another…though he started in the early 70’s before he made it big……Prince might be another…..but the names do not come as fast and furious as the 1955-1975 era. Billy Bob argued that music is dying…at least music that will last for centuries to come. Surely, 200 years from now, you will still be listening to Beatles songs just like we listen to old classical music today…….Will we listening to Jonas Brothers or Miley Cyrus songs 200 years from now? I don’t think so…… I think Billy Bob got this one right. Looking at my own music collection, 75% of the music is from pre-1985 or so.
